Common Issues with Clio Key Fobs

To successfully resolve the problems impacting Clio key fobs, it's vital to recognize the most typical issues. Below is a table summarizing these concerns along with their prospective options:

ProblemDescriptionSymptomsPossible Solutions
Dead BatteryThe most regular problem. Batteries can diminish in time.Infrequency in unlocking/locking functions.Replace the battery.
Physical DamageWear and tear can affect fob functionality.Broken casing, unresponsive buttons.Repair or replace physical elements.
Water DamageDirect exposure to wetness can harm internal components.Fob ends up being unresponsive.Dry the fob and clean the circuit board.
Internal Circuit FailureElectronic malfunctions due to age or impact.Inconsistent variety, fob not recognized by the car.Professional diagnostics and repair needed.
Programming IssuesThe fob may become desynchronized with the car.Fob stops working to unlock the car.Reprogramming through dealer or specialized service.

Action 3: Addressing Water Damage

  1. Dry the Fob:

    • If the fob has actually been exposed to water, remove the battery and leave it to dry for a minimum of 24 hours.
  2. Clean Internal Components:

    • If you're comfy, open the fob and carefully tidy the electronic components with isopropyl alcohol.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How typically should I replace my key fob battery?

Key fob batteries typically last between 2 to 3 years. It's suggested to replace it faster if you see decreased range or responsiveness.

2. Can I fix a broken key fob housing?

Yes, you can either repair a fracture utilizing superglue or tape for a short-lived fix, or acquire a replacement key fob shell to transfer the internal parts safely.

3. What should I do if my key fob will not open the car?

Start with the easiest services: replace the battery and guarantee no water damage exists. If those do not work, it may need reprogramming or expert diagnostics.

4. Is it safe to clean my key fob?

Yes, but do so carefully utilizing isopropyl alcohol and a cotton swab to avoid harmful sensitive parts.

5. Can I get a duplicate key fob quickly?

Yes, but the process might differ. Generally, a dealer, vehicle locksmith, or specialized service can produce a replicate; simply guarantee you have the original fob on hand.
